Detailed Explanation

Program Management

What

Program management is the strategic oversight of complex, cross-functional initiatives across a business. It is the single largest recruitment category for graduates, accounting for nearly 39.2% of all student placements.

Why

Startups scale rapidly and often drop critical operational balls between departments. Companies need sharp operators who can sit between engineering, product, and sales to keep major projects moving forward on time.

How

A program manager sets explicit timeline milestones, aligns different team targets, and eliminates structural bottlenecks. For example, if a company like Zepto expands its dark-store footprint in a new city, a program manager coordinates real estate, logistics technology, and regional hiring.

The real-world implication is massive. You develop a reputation as a highly dependable execution engine, which positions you perfectly for future executive business operations roles.

Founder’s Office

What

A role in the Founder's Office makes you a direct strategic extension of the Chief Executive Officer or founder. It acts as an internal entrepreneurial generalist role where you solve the company's highest-priority problems.

Why

Founders cannot be everywhere at once as their business hyper-scales. They need trusted, analytically rigorous partners who can evaluate new business verticals or fix broken operational processes without constant hand-holding.

How

You spend your weeks analyzing industry trends, building financial models for new investments, or stepping in as an interim leader for unmanaged teams. For example, if a growth-stage company wants to launch a new product line on Product Hunt or expand into international markets, you handle the initial ground research.

This role offers incredible visibility. You sit in on critical board meetings and learn exactly how business leaders make high-stakes decisions.

Product Management

What

Product management is the functional art of defining the "what," "why," and "when" of a digital product. You guide engineering and design teams to build software features that solve real user problems.

Why

An institution that uses an AI-first curriculum ensures its graduates actually understand modern technology stacks. Startups do not just need abstract managers; they need people who can build and deploy functional tools.

How

You write detailed product requirement documents, track user retention metrics, and run A/B conversion tests. Through hands-on tracks like the Build Your Own Product framework, you ship actual code and learn how to manage technical debt.

The real-world implication is clear. You leave the program with a tangible portfolio of shipped digital assets, which gives you immense credibility with engineering teams.

How It Works

The path to building sustainable Startup Careers After Mesa runs through a highly structured four-stage experiential learning flywheel.

  • Phase 1: Foundations & No-Code Assembly: Students learn the fundamentals of modern business operations, Unit Economics, and algorithmic logic. You learn how to map business data without relying on heavy engineering teams.
  • Phase 2: Build Your Own Business (BYOB): You are grouped with peers, handed real capital, and tasked with launching a live micro-enterprise. You manage real customer acquisition and handle real revenue.
  • Phase 3: The Startup Lab Incubator: Students pitch, iterate, and build under the direct guidance of active venture capital firms. You get access to a ₹5 crore fund to stress-test your ideas against real-market conditions.
  • Phase 4: Industry Placement Drive: The formal transition pipeline connects students directly with fast-growing internet ecosystems like Meesho, Urban Company, and Flipkart.

Fees / Cost

Investing in specialized business education requires a clear analysis of financial inputs versus eventual career output.

  • Tuition Fees: The comprehensive program tuition stands at ₹27.45 Lakhs for the full Postgraduate cycle.
  • Living Costs: Expect an additional ₹1.5 to ₹2.5 Lakhs annually for accommodation, food, and local transit within Bangalore.
  • Scholarships: Meritorious candidates, diverse profiles, and founders with past execution experience can qualify for partial financial aid.
  • Return on Investment (ROI): With an average incoming profile jumping to a ₹26 Lakhs average compensation package, most graduates recover their capital layout within 14 to 18 months of graduation.
